Planer Mill Manager

LaValley Building Supply LLC
Middleton, NH Full Time
POSTED ON 5/8/2026
AVAILABLE BEFORE 7/7/2026

About the Role:

The Planer Mill Manager is responsible for overseeing all operations within the planer mill to ensure efficient, safe, and high-quality production of lumber products. This role requires managing the daily workflow, coordinating with maintenance and production teams, and implementing process improvements to optimize output and reduce waste. The manager will lead a team of operators and technicians, fostering a culture of safety, continuous improvement, and teamwork. They will also be responsible for maintaining compliance with industry regulations and company standards while managing budgets and resources effectively. Ultimately, the Planer Mill Manager ensures that production goals are met on time and within budget while maintaining the highest standards of quality and safety.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ent; technical or vocational training in manufacturing or related field preferred.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in planer mill operations or a similar manufacturing environment.
  • Proven experience in a supervisory or management role within a production or manufacturing setting.
  • Strong knowledge of planer mill machinery, safety standards, and production processes.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ical documents, production schedules, and safety regulations.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Familiarity with computerized maintenance management systems (CMMS) and production tracking software,  Microsoft skills, word and excel.
  • Strong leadership Skills

Responsibilities:

  • Supervise and coordinate daily operations of the planer mill to meet production targets and quality standards.
  • Manage and lead a team of mill operators, maintenance staff, and support personnel
  • Develop and implement operational procedures and safety protocols to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and company policies.
  • Monitor equipment performance and coordinate maintenance activities to minimize downtime and extend machinery life.
  • Analyze production data and implement process improvements to increase efficiency, reduce waste, and optimize resource utilization.
  • Collaborate with supply chain, quality control, and other departments to ensure smooth production flow and timely delivery of products.
  • Prepare and manage budgets, control costs, and report on operational performance to senior management.

Skills:

The Planer Mill Manager utilizes technical skills daily to understand and optimize machinery operations and production workflows. Leadership and communication skills are essential for managing teams, conducting training, and fostering a positive work environment focused on safety and efficiency. Analytical skills are applied to interpret production data, identify bottlenecks, and implement process improvements that enhance productivity and reduce costs. Problem-solving abilities are critical when addressing equipment malfunctions or operational challenges to minimize downtime. Additionally, organizational skills are used to manage schedules, budgets, and compliance documentation, ensuring smooth and compliant mill operations.

Salary : $80,000 - $90,000
